The CL800 dominated our testing with True RMS accuracy that catches harmonic distortions from modern appliances—a must-have for diagnosing dimmer switches and HVAC circuits. Its 1000V rating and integrated non-contact voltage tester (NCVT) provide critical safety margins for main panel work, while auto-ranging eliminates guesswork for beginners.
What separates the CL800 is the LoZ mode that prevents ghost voltage false readings on shared neutrals—a common headache in residential wiring. The backlit display, temperature probe, and frequency measurement turn this into a complete electrical diagnostics station that grows with your skills.
